Story Structure — 4 Plot Phases

Solace in Milan

Antonio Dorigo navigates his isolation in Milan, seeking comfort at Ermelina's establishment. His routine life shifts when he schedules an appointment with Laide, an underage dancer who becomes the focal point of his emotional journey.

The Transactional Bond

Antonio's romantic idealism clashes with Laide's desire for a strictly physical relationship. They enter a kept woman arrangement that allows Laide independence while binding Antonio to an obsessive devotion.

The Illusion of Marriage

As Laide grows impatient with Antonio's age and intrusiveness, he remains blinded by love. Seeking a conventional path, Antonio marries another woman, temporarily distancing himself from the chaotic bond.

The Inevitable Reckoning

Antonio realizes too late that Laide was his true love and desperately attempts to reconnect. The final meeting ends in rejection, cementing his permanent loss and leaving him with lingering regret.

Story Breakdown

The love life of an aging architect used to love affairs with call girls, who in the end settles down with a girl of his class but still longs for the life he has led so far, which ends in disillusion.
